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Whatstandwell to Surbiton start from as little as £18.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Whatstandwell to Surbiton start from £93.00 one way, or £96.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Whatstandwell to Surbiton are available for £124.10 one way, or £243.30 return

Everything you need to know about Whatstandwell Station

Discovering Whatstandwell Train Station

Situated in the picturesque Derwent Valley along the scenic route linking Matlock and Derby, Whatstandwell Station is a quaint railway stopover. Nestled amidst lush greenery, the station serves as both a starting point for local exploration and a convenient location for longer journeys across the UK. With its charming rural setting, it's the perfect spot for those seeking respite from the hustle and bustle of larger stations. The station is known for its basic amenities, but it’s precisely this simplicity coupled with its beautiful surroundings that adds to its allure.

Facilities and Amenities

Though Whatstandwell Station lacks many of the facilities found at larger stations, travellers can still access essential services. For ticketing requirements, there are accessible ticket machines where you can collect pre-booked tickets, and an induction loop is available to ensure everyone can effectively manage their travel plans. There's no ticket office, but with ticket machines available, the process remains hassle-free.

Accessibility is thoughtfully considered with step-free access to some parts of the station, supported by tactile paving for visually impaired passengers. Mind, however, that amenities such as waiting rooms and refreshment facilities aren't present here, so plan accordingly. The station is covered by CCTV, adding a layer of security, and assistance is available through help points, ensuring that support is on hand when needed.

Station Facilities and Ticketing

The station is equipped with a ticket office with generous opening hours, available from 06:30 to 20:30 on weekdays, slightly reduced on weekends. For those purchasing tickets in advance, online purchase and collection through ticket machines is also streamlined at Surbiton Station. Accessibility is prioritized with facilities such as induction loops, ramps for train access, and accessible ticket machines ensuring everyone can travel with ease. South Western Railway's smartcard system includes issuance and validation, offering a seamless travel experience.

Accessibility and Facilities

Surbiton Station caters to a diverse range of needs with partial step-free access via lifts and accessible toilets. Although the rear South Bank entrance lacks step-free access, assistance is always available. Multiple customer help points are situated throughout, ensuring travelers receive the support they need. Additionally, bicycle storage facilities provide secure spaces equipped with CCTV, accommodating up to 330 bicycles.
